Topic Reactivity of Stable Nitrogen-Centered Radicals and Their Use in the Preparation of Potentially Bioactive Nitrogen-Containing Compounds
Faculty FCHT / FPBT VŠCHT, PřF UK
Abstract

Stable nitrogen-centered radicals like verdazyls display a diverse reactivity for example as mediators in living radical polymerizations, as ligands for transition metals and molecular magnetic materials,1,2 however, they have been rarely applied in organic chemistry. In this project, the reactivity of verdazyl in radical heterocoupling reactions and new rearrangement reactions will be explored. The obtained compounds will be tested for their biological activities.
